James 5:14-15

14 Is anyone ill? let him summon the presbyters of the church, and let them pray over him, anointing him with oil in the name of the Lord; 15 the prayer of faith will restore the sick man, and the Lord will raise him up; even the sins he has committed will be forgiven him.

Mark 5:25-26

25 And there was a woman who had had a hemorrhage for twelve years — 26 she had suffered a great deal under a number of doctors and had spent all her means but was none the better; in fact she was rather worse.

Mark 2:17

17 On hearing this, Jesus said to them, "Those who are strong have no need of a doctor, but those who are ill: I have not come to call just men but sinners."
